Countess of Beusichem, Countess van Beusichem (Boesinchem), wife of Count Johan van Beusichem. She was the daughter of the Lord of Heusden. Standing full-length with the coat of arms of Heusden. Part of an illustrated manuscript with the genealogy of the lords and counts of Culemborg. Attributed to Nicolaes de Kemp.
